Self Storage Fort Lauderdale

Tamarac Mini Storage

Address
Place
Fort Lauderdale , FL 33301
Landline
(954) 349-2761

Description

Tamarac Mini Storage can be found at . The following is offered: Self Storage - In Fort Lauderdale there are 21 other Self Storage.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Self Storage
(954)349-2761 (954)-349-2761 +19543492761

Map